Figure 1 in New host detection of the parasitic mite, Erythraeus pistacicus (Trombidiformes: Erythraeidae) from Iran and indication of possible infection with bacterial symbionts
Figure 1. Erythraeus (Erythraeus) pistacicus Haitlinger, Mehrnejad & Šundić, 2016 larva (Black arrow)inside the gall, feeding on the aphid, Forda hirsuta Mordvilko, 1928, on pistachio trees. June 2022, Mashhad, Northeast of Iran.
